npm资源库中的组件如何升级?
在当今快速发展的前端开发领域,使用npm资源库中的组件已经成为许多开发者的首选。这些组件不仅提高了开发效率,还降低了开发成本。然而,随着技术的不断进步,组件也需要不断升级以适应新的需求。那么,如何升级npm资源库中的组件呢?本文将详细介绍这一过程。
一、了解组件升级的意义
组件升级是前端开发中的一项重要工作。它不仅可以修复已知的问题,还可以引入新的功能,提高组件的性能和兼容性。以下是组件升级的几个重要意义:
- 修复已知问题:随着组件的使用,开发者可能会发现一些已知的问题。升级组件可以帮助修复这些问题,确保应用的稳定运行。
- 引入新功能:随着技术的不断发展,新的功能需求不断涌现。升级组件可以引入这些新功能,满足开发者需求。
- 提高性能和兼容性:升级组件可以提高其性能和兼容性,使应用更加流畅和稳定。
二、组件升级前的准备工作
在升级组件之前,需要进行以下准备工作:
- 备份当前项目:在升级组件之前,建议备份当前项目,以防止升级过程中出现意外导致项目损坏。
- 查看组件升级日志:在升级组件之前,需要查看组件的升级日志,了解升级过程中可能遇到的问题和注意事项。
- 确定升级版本:根据项目需求和组件升级日志,确定要升级到的版本。
三、组件升级的具体步骤
以下是升级npm资源库中组件的具体步骤:
- 更新package.json:打开项目根目录下的package.json文件,找到需要升级的组件,并修改其版本号。例如,将“vue@2.6.10”修改为“vue@2.6.11”。
- 运行npm install:在命令行中执行“npm install”命令,npm会自动下载并安装更新后的组件。
- 检查依赖关系:升级组件后,需要检查是否有其他依赖项受到影响。如果有,需要根据实际情况进行相应的调整。
- 测试:升级组件后,需要进行充分测试,确保应用的稳定运行。
四、案例分析
以下是一个升级vue组件的案例分析:
假设当前项目使用的是vue@2.6.10版本,需要升级到vue@2.6.11版本。
- 打开项目根目录下的package.json文件,将“vue@2.6.10”修改为“vue@2.6.11”。
- 在命令行中执行“npm install”命令,npm会自动下载并安装更新后的vue组件。
- 检查是否有其他依赖项受到影响。如果有,根据实际情况进行相应的调整。
- 进行充分测试,确保应用的稳定运行。
五、总结
升级npm资源库中的组件是前端开发中的一项重要工作。通过了解组件升级的意义、准备工作、具体步骤和案例分析,开发者可以更加轻松地完成组件升级。在升级过程中,要注意备份项目、查看升级日志、确定升级版本、检查依赖关系和进行充分测试,以确保应用的稳定运行。
猜你喜欢:DeepFlow